デバイス測定による毛細血管再充満時間による救急科における重症患者の特定

まとめ
救急科におけるデバイス測定による毛細血管再充満時間(CRT)は、患者の重症度を示す有用な指標です。CRTの延長は、重症度スコアの上昇と関連しており、早期特定に役立ちます。

背景:
- 毛細血管再充満時間(CRT)は、組織灌流の非侵襲的測定法です。
- 救急部門(ED)におけるその有用性、特に定量デバイスを用いた場合の有用性は、さらなる調査が必要です。
研究 の 目的:
- ED到着時のデバイス測定によるCRTと臨床的重症度との関連を評価すること。
- CRTが重症患者の早期特定に役立つかどうかを判断すること。
主な方法:
- 救急車で到着した119人の成人患者を対象とした前向き単一施設観察研究。
- 定量CRTデバイスを使用して測定を行い、3回の測定値の平均値を分析した。
- 重症度はAPACHE IIスコアが25以上と定義した。
主要な成果:
- CRTは、APACHE IIスコアが高い患者(2.56秒 vs 1.67秒、p=0.0012)で有意に延長していた。
- デバイス測定によるCRTは、乳酸(0.702 vs 0.669)よりも高いROC曲線下面積を示した。
- CRTは乳酸と正の相関を示し、SOFAスコアとは傾向が見られた。
結論:
- デバイス測定によるCRTは、EDにおける臨床的重症度と関連していた。
- CRTは、重症患者を特定するための早期マーカーとして機能する可能性がある。
- 定量CRT評価は、救急設定におけるさらなる臨床的有用性研究に値する。
